Output ee590898c40bfcae5031410c35c1c921d21b00d197b42ba05a8d11f6615d365a:1

value
17076419
script pubkey
OP_0 OP_PUSHBYTES_20 4b2409b72be756595d082617875fcef6823de984
address
bc1qfvjqndetuat9jhggyctcwh7w76prm6vymeqr5q
transaction
ee590898c40bfcae5031410c35c1c921d21b00d197b42ba05a8d11f6615d365a
spent
true